CooRie is a self-produced Japanese music unit by singer-songwriter rino who performs songs for anime and games. CooRie used to be a two-persons unit when it debuted in 2003, with rino doing the lyrics and vocals and Naoyuki Osada (長田直之, Osada Naoyuki?) doing the music compositions and arrangement… read more

Lia (りあ, born Dec. 20) is a J-pop, trance, and techno happy hardcore singer-songwriter and artist who is best known for her work in the visual novel AIR, with melancholic songs such as Natsukage, Tori no Uta (鳥の詩) and Farewell song. Her music has also been featured in several other studio Key vi… read more
